Job Purpose
Emirates Engineering’s Overhaul Workshops stand at the forefront of global aviation maintenance, delivering world‑class capability across airframe, engine, cabin and component services. Equipped with advanced tooling, automated diagnostics, and highly certified engineers, the workshops support some of the world’s most sophisticated fleets with precision, reliability, and uncompromising safety. From heavy checks to complex structural repairs, Emirates Engineering ensures every aircraft leaves performing at peak efficiency.
As Engine Overhaul Engineer II you will oversee engine overhaul activities from disassembly through to testing and release to service, ensuring all work is performed to the highest safety, quality, regulatory, and airworthiness standards and the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) recommendation.
In This Tole You Will
Ensure all assigned tasks are completed in accordance with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) data, as well as EEMC/EOW documentation, procedures, and regulatory requirements.
Supervise, mentor, and support Engineers, Senior Technicians, Technicians, and Mechanics, ensuring work is completed efficiently and aligned with individual performance objectives. Provide constructive feedback and coaching to address performance gaps and support continuous improvement.
Perform and oversee maintenance activities using expertise in engine overhaul processes, company procedures, and approved maintenance data, including ESM, IPC, CMM, SBs and ADs. Ensure all maintenance records, paperwork, and MRO ERP transactions are completed accurately and in a timely manner.
Utilize approved tooling, equipment, and facilities to carry out maintenance activities safely and to the highest quality standards. Ensure team compliance with all safety, quality, and operational procedures.
Promote and maintain a safe working environment in line with EEMC/EOW Safety Policies. Report safety and quality non-conformances promptly, take immediate action to mitigate unsafe conditions, and ensure incidents, hazards, and near-miss events are reported and escalated to the Line Manager or Operations Manager as required.
Monitor attendance and ensure team compliance with approved shift patterns. Address attendance and conduct issues in accordance with company policies and disciplinary procedures. Lead daily toolbox talks when required, actively participate in operational meetings, and drive initiatives that improve processes, efficiency, and best practices.
Develop and coach team members by providing technical training, mentoring, and guidance. Support Technicians in achieving self-certification approvals, prepare Senior Technicians for Inspector approvals, and identify development opportunities to enhance capability, skills, and regulatory compliance knowledge.
Manage workforce planning effectively using the approved roster system, ensuring resources are allocated efficiently to meet operational requirements while maintaining overtime within budgeted limits.
Set annual performance goals and competency expectations for team members, conducting regular quarterly and annual performance reviews to support development and business objectives.
Qualification
To be considered for this role you must meet the following requirements:
Degree in Engineering in Aeronautical subjects, Mechanical, Maintenance, Avionics, Electronics Tech Engineering or Valid Maintenance Engineering Licence or Apprenticeship (at least 2 years).
9+ years in aviation maintenance or MRO environment with at least 2 years certifying experience as an Approval Holder in a reputable airline or MRO company.
Must hold the relevant Engine overhaul workshop approval/authorisation.
